Window damage can be caused by shifting foundations

Having a foundation that is moving can cause damage to windows. Foundation settling can cause walls to bow and doors to sag and windows to fall out of alignment. These issues can lead to in structural flaws and costly repairs.

The best method to determine whether your home has a shifting foundation is to take a look at the concrete walls in your basement. It could be necessary to contract a foundation repair company in the event that you notice cracks or gaps in the wall.

A foundation that is shifting can cause walls to bow and doors to sag and upvc windows repair to move out of alignment and flooring to become uneven. The cracks and gaps which are created can allow moisture to seep into your home.

The gaps between frames and walls are an indication that your foundation is shifting. These gaps can be caused either by movement in the foundation or water, or even plumbing leaks. These issues can be solved by a foundation repair firm to bring your home back into its former.

The windows in your home are a great way to determine if your foundation is shifting. You might see condensation or a gap between the windows at the top and the bottom. These issues could be caused by condensation or a gap at the top and bottom of the window. A foundation repair company could be able to give an estimate at no cost.

The best way to determine if your foundation is shifting is to look for the hairline cracks that are typical with a foundation that is shifting. While they're not always a sign that something is wrong, hairline cracks can be an indication that your home is shifting.

Fallsing out of a window is the most common accident for children who live at home.

It doesn't matter if you're a mother, child care provider, or just an concerned citizen falling out of windows is a common and potentially dangerous accident for children living at home. The dangers are often hidden, but can be prevented with simple measures.

A recent study revealed that a child falls from windows about every eight minutes. This means that more than 190 kids are injured each year due to falling out of windows.

The Center for Injury Research and Policy at Nationwide Children's Hospital conducted the study. The study evaluated data from a nationwide database of children treated in emergency rooms of hospitals. The information included information on the child's age, gender and injuries. The children were assessed to determine their risk factors as well as determine the most frequent kinds of injuries.

The study looked at a total of 98,415 children treated in emergency rooms of hospitals between 1990 and 2008. The study revealed that children aged 5 and under are the most at risk of falling from a window. In addition to falling out of windows These children are also more likely to suffer serious head injuries.

The study showed that almost half of the injuries were due to head trauma. The severity of head injuries can be determined by the landing area for children. Concrete is the most frequent landing surface for children younger than five years old. For window repairs children between six and seven years of age, the landing surface is usually a balcony or railing.

The study revealed that 88 children fell from a third floor or lower window. Around half of all window accidents occurred between noon and 6pm. The remainder was observed between 6pm and midnight.

Average cost of door and window repairs

Maintaining your windows and doors in good condition can improve the appearance of your home and reduce your energy bills. If they're not performing properly, it may be time to get them fixed.

The cost of fixing the door or window depends on the size, material and design. The majority of homeowners spend between $175 to $220 on repairs. The severity of damage, the price could go up to $1,000 or more.
